Shane’s Take — Shoeless Joe
Field of Dreams holds a special place for me that probably far exceeds the logical quality of the movie. I love baseball, and the story is so magical that you can’t help but come away with a special feeling. I don’t generally read books that are based on movies that I like. I thought I’d make an exception here since I came across a list of the best baseball books and this was on it. Unfortunately, I think the movie is far superior to the book. There are some minor differences, but that was expected. I think the main drawback of the book is that it was way too scattered for me. It often seems that when the plot is stalling, the voice appears to move the story forward. Things don’t seem to advance in a natural manner to me. The movie is able to soften some of these rough edges and is actually a little more natural and believable to me. All of this might lead you to believe that I dislike the book. I don’t dislike it, but I just didn’t love it either. I’m still glad I read it though.
